What is the TCF French Certificate?
The TCF is a formally recognized French language proficiency test established by the French Ministry of Education. It is created for non-native speakers and evaluates their command of the French language in various contexts. The TCF is especially beneficial for:
Individuals looking for to study in French-speaking countries.Experts wanting to boost their resumes.Those aiming to immigrate to French-speaking regions.Key Features of the TCF
The TCF is divided into different elements that examine listening, reading, composing, and speaking skills. The following table sums up the important functions of the TCF:

There is no official passing rating for the TCF, as it is developed to determine efficiency throughout levels A1 to C2. Nevertheless, different organizations might have their own requirements.
Q2: How long does it require to get results?
Results are usually readily available within a couple of weeks after taking the test.
Q3: Can I take the TCF online?
Yes, the TCF can be taken online. Many authorized centers provide this option, enabling flexibility in scheduling.
